## Ownership

The Copperquill spreadsheet exporter is memory-bound: exports above 100k rows must use the streaming writer, not the legacy builder. Peak RSS is tracked on the Thornvale dashboard; regressions over 10% block release. Raise issues at the weekly sync. Current owner for export memory work is listed below.

named custodian: Oliath Ralax

Q: Why is permessage-deflate off by default on Wirefall sockets?
A: Compression saves ~60% bandwidth on chatty JSON frames but costs CPU and memory per connection — context takeover alone eats ~300KB per socket. At Brindlehop's scale that's gigabytes of RAM. Enable it only for low-fanout, high-payload channels. Benchmarks live in the perf repo. Flag: ws_compress_opt_in. Don't enable on the telemetry tier; it's already CPU-bound. To flip the flag you'll need the ops vault open, which requires the recovery passphrase below.

unlock words, yawig-kagef: gordor-holvan-ulaael-pramir-ulaiel-tamdor

## Configuration

Offline mode is the whole point of Fieldnook, so don't skip this section. When the app loses signal out near the Drywell Basin survey sites, it queues observations in a local store and syncs them once connectivity returns. The env file controls queue size, retry backoff, and the sync endpoint — sane defaults are baked in, so only override them if you know why. The sync handshake does need an encryption key to seal the queued payloads, so put that key on the next line.

vault entry, yahif-yajep: COURIER_KEY29=b802bdf8034096b65a51c6ba5abe2

- [ ] Step 7: Archive cold storage buckets (Glacierline tier). Confirm both ceremony witnesses are present, verify bucket manifests match the Oxbow ledger, then seal the archive key shares. Plugin authors may observe but not handle shares. Once sealed, the archive index itself is encrypted and can only be reopened with the passphrase below.

vault phrase of badup-hahig = tamael-aldael-kelmir-istael-fenok-istwyn-tamius-jorath-oliion

## Configuration

As of 3.2, the old Hopcart job queue is gone; background work now flows through Stavenly. Release builds must include the Stavenly broker settings in the environment file before cutover, or workers will silently idle. Set the broker auth secret on the next line:

sealed setting: ARCHIVE_KEY3=8d0